在移动互联网时代,微信已经成为人们日常生活中不可或缺的一部分。公众号作为微信的重要功能,其互动率的高低直接影响到品牌或个人影响力的扩大。而微信分享功能则是提升公众号互动率的关键。本文将详细解析如何使用JavaScript实现微信分享功能,帮助您轻松提升公众号互动率。
第一步:获取微信JS-SDK
首先,您需要获取微信JS-SDK。微信JS-SDK是微信官方提供的一套JavaScript接口,可以帮助开发者快速在网页中实现微信的一些功能。
- 访问微信开放平台官网(https://open.weixin.qq.com/)。
- 登录您的微信公众平台,选择“开发者中心”。
- 在“JS-SDK调试工具”中,填写您的公众号相关信息,获取AppID。
- 复制生成的JS-SDK代码,将其添加到您的网页中。
第二步:引入微信JS-SDK
将获取到的JS-SDK代码添加到您的网页中,确保在调用微信接口前,JS-SDK代码已经加载完成。
<script src="https://res.wx.qq.com/open/js/jweixin-1.6.0.js"></script>
第三步:配置微信JS-SDK
在您的网页中,通过JavaScript代码配置微信JS-SDK的相关参数。
wx.config({
debug: true, // 开启调试模式,调用的所有api的返回值会在客户端打印出来。
appId: '您的AppID', // 公众号的唯一标识
timestamp: '时间戳', // 随机时间戳
nonceStr: '随机字符串', // 随机字符串
signature: '签名', // 签名
jsApiList: [
'checkJsApi',
'onMenuShareTimeline',
'onMenuShareAppMessage',
// 其他需要调用的接口
] // 需要使用的JS接口列表
});
第四步:实现微信分享功能
在配置好微信JS-SDK后,您可以通过以下步骤实现微信分享功能:
- 获取用户点击的分享按钮。
- 调用微信JS-SDK的
onMenuShareTimeline
或onMenuShareAppMessage
接口。 - 设置分享的标题、描述、图片、链接等信息。
以下是一个简单的示例:
// 用户点击分享按钮时触发
document.getElementById('share-btn').addEventListener('click', function() {
wx.onMenuShareTimeline({
title: '分享标题',
link: '分享链接',
imgUrl: '分享图片',
success: function() {
// 用户分享成功后的回调
},
cancel: function() {
// 用户取消分享后的回调
}
});
wx.onMenuShareAppMessage({
title: '分享标题',
desc: '分享描述',
link: '分享链接',
imgUrl: '分享图片',
type: 'link',
dataUrl: '',
success: function() {
// 用户分享成功后的回调
},
cancel: function() {
// 用户取消分享后的回调
}
});
});
第五步:优化分享效果
为了提升微信分享的效果,您可以采取以下措施:
- 设计吸引人的分享图片和标题。
- 优化分享链接,确保用户在点击分享后能够顺利访问到目标页面。
- 在分享成功后,给予用户一定的奖励,如积分、优惠券等。
通过以上五个步骤,您可以使用JavaScript实现微信分享功能,从而提升公众号的互动率。希望本文对您有所帮助!